"description": "\u003cp\u003eWhile the most ancient perfume bottles, called alabaster, were formed of its namesake material, quickly their makers turned to glass in patterns mimicking lapis and marble. The elongated, drop-like vessels held cedar, rose, amber, and myrrh, among other popular oils, variously chosen for their soothing or sensual qualities.
